Transaction 66e3ca8085bfefb4451dccf72278f77ba07f6e204e4632a286819c8d197c34fe
1 Input
1 Output
-
66e3ca8085bfefb4451dccf72278f77ba07f6e204e4632a286819c8d197c34fe:0
- value
- 396351
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10a9051761d93bec363559d8804d12e21acd0336 OP_EQUAL
- address
- 33D7DKZEJfgbq7qPsRMFteuMnjZRCCAfii